Subject: Mira Mar
David Ritter called today to brief me on the outcome of the hearing today on the Mira Mar case. David said the judge could
not have ruled more favorably than he did. The judge threw out all claims for attorney fees, by far the largest dollar
amount of any claim, and most of the specific issues. The judge ruled that the Council's hearing and resulting Findings of
Facts & Conclusion of Law was satisfactory and that the decisions made by Council are valid with one exception. He
awarded an additional $8,000 related to the cost of the land and construction of the sidewalk adjacent to the development.
The judge indicated that he may dispose of the case at a November 5 hearing at which he will rule on our motion for
summary judgement. Otherwise, the few remaining issues that were not related to the proportionality argument are
scheduled to go to trial in December.
